Another Hawaii fighter gets UFC fight in July

Billy Hull

Kapolei’s Louis Smolka has been added to the UFC 189 pay-per-view card on July 11 in a flyweight bout against Irishman Neil Seery, the UFC has confirmed.

Smolka will fight a day before fellow Hawaii Elite MMA training partner Russell Doane faces Jerrod Sanders at the TUF Finale 21 event in the same MGM Grand Garden Arena in Las Vegas.

Smolka (8-1, 2-1 UFC) is coming off a third-round finish of Richie Vaculik last November in a fight he took on 11 days notice.

His only UFC loss was by a split decision.

Seery (15-10) has won two consecutive UFC fight since losing his debut to Brad Pickett last May. He has gone the distance all three times.
